源码相减规,为什么源码相减等于补码相加
原标题:源码相减规,为什么源码相减等于补码相加
导读:
求完整的基于DCT的数字水印的潜入和提取源码(vc)【重谢】数字水印技术是通过一定的算法将一些标志性信息直接嵌到多媒体内容中,目前大多数水印制作方...
求完整的基于DCT的数字水印的潜入和提取源码(vc)【重谢】
数字水印技术是通过一定的算法将一些标志性信息直接嵌到多媒体内容中,目前大多数水印制作方案都采用密码学中的加密(包括公开密钥、私有密钥)体系来加强,在水印的嵌入,提取时采用一种密钥,甚至几种密钥的联合使用。
目前,大部分的DCT水印方法采用的是基于DCT的8x8图像块。
该方法即使当水印图像经过一些通用的几何变形和信号处理操作而产生比较明显的变形后仍然能够提取出一个可信赖的水印拷贝。一个简单改进是不将水印嵌入到DCT域的低频分量上,而是嵌入到中频分量上以调节水印的顽健性与不可见性之间的矛盾。
DCT嵌入是,做完DCT在选着频段嵌入的。而你的这个代码是,选着频段然后嵌入,然后做整体做DCT,在整体的嵌入,这样没有多要意义。没间隔9个采样点然后提取一个信号,也就是10个一循环。这本身就是一种选着频段要嵌入的手段了,而对他做DCT,你不论是在DC分量还是AC分量均嵌入水印。
DCT是一种频域变换方法,将图像分解为频率成分,捕获关键特性。待隐藏信息通常需进行编码,以安全嵌入图像中,可能涉及差错控制和加密技术。为了提高安全性,有时会在嵌入信息的同时嵌入水印,用于验证图像真实性和完整性。解码和提取过程包括识别和还原嵌入信息,以及解密编码信息(若有)。
我看你的视图是前视图,所以在前视图的空白区点击右键,在菜单中选择“unfreeze all”也就是取消所有冻结。然后选择你用红框框住的哪一堆东西,注意!要让他变成白色(选不中??,用框选的,把他全框住!!)轻松的按一下键盘上的Delete也就是删除。你的问题就解决了。
什么是逆向工程?
1、逆向工程,又称为反求工程,英文名为reverse engineering,是一种通过分析已存在的产品或系统,来推导出其工作原理和实现方法的技术。它不仅仅局限于软件领域,在硬件、机械乃至生物工程中都有广泛的应用。
2、逆向工程是和正向工程相对的一项技术,据市场不完全统计,在现实生活中有百分之三十的工作是通过正向思维方式完成的,而有百分之七十的工作是通过逆向方式进行的,由此我们不难发现逆向工程的重要性,尤其是在工业制造业领域,逆向工程的价值非同一般。
3、逆向工程是指通过分析已有的软件系统来获取其内部设计和实现的过程。逆向工程的目的是理解已有的软件系统的结构、功能和工作方式,以帮助开发人员进行修改、扩展或者重新设计。逆向工程通常包括反编译、反汇编、静态分析、动态分析等技术手段,以便还原出软件的设计、算法和代码逻辑呢。
4、逆向工程(又称逆向技术),是一种产品设计技术再现过程,即对一项目标产品进行逆向分析及研究,从而演绎并得出该产品的处理流程、组织结构、功能特性及技术规格等设计要素,以制作出功能相近,但又不完全一样的产品。至诚工业逆向工程源于商业及军事领域中的硬件分析。
triumph怎么快速的记忆
triumph联想记忆方法,tri(缩写:三个)+um(联想:游民)+ph(ph试纸)→三个游民的试验获得成功。n.胜利;巨大成功;重大成就;(巨大成功或胜利的)心满意足;狂喜;(成功的)典范;楷模;vi.成功;战胜;打败。She gave a little crow of triumph.她轻轻地发出了胜利的欢呼声。
曲率大小变化云图法(对于一个完全光顺的 class 1 曲面,相当于曲率大小变化为零,对于两个不同曲面,此值会不同)将扫描数据分开,这样可以很快地捕捉产品的主要特征,并迅速建立各个相应曲面,避免了费事的分析和处理。
- Centaur(半人马)可以谐音记忆为“神驼,神马Pegasus”。- Apothegm(格言)可以谐音记忆为“爱不释手”。- Asparagus(芦笋)可以谐音记忆为“一次拔了根吃”。- Custodian(管理员)可以谐音记忆为“卡死偷电”。- Chef和Triumph可以谐音记忆为“脑袋大脖子粗,不是大款就是伙夫”。
图像记忆,顾名思义,采用图像的方法帮助记忆。与传统的声音刺激记忆相比效率要提高3-10倍。结合思维导图,快速阅读及其它方法就可以做到轻松高效记忆文章的效果。图像记忆的要领是图像必须精简,夸张,生动有趣。如果很普通的图像记忆就没法对神经进行刺激,不过普通的图像也总比用声音刺激带来的记忆强些。
成功 例句:The soldiers exulted at their victory.战士们为取得胜利而欢跃。victory,conquest,triumph这些名词均有“胜利”之意。victory普通用词,主要指在战争、斗争或竞赛中获得的胜利,侧重艰辛与成功。conquest指获取胜利或征服,把败者置于控制之下。triumph着重胜利或成功的辉煌与彻底。
读法:英 [vkt()r] 美 [vktri]释义:n. 胜利;成功;克服 n. (Victory)人名;(西)维多利;(英)维克托里 Victory Games胜利游戏 Victory Medal胜利奖章 Victory Day胜利日 例句:We drank to her victory.我们为她的胜利干杯。
啥是逆向工程
1、逆向工程是一种通过分析已有的东西和结果,推导出具体的实现方法的过程。它涉及到多个领域和技术,包括反汇编、反编译、动态跟踪、逆向软件工程等。
2、逆向工程,有的人也叫反求工程,英文是reverse engineering。是指从实物上采集大量的三维坐标点,并由此建立该物体的几何模型,进而开发出同类产品的先进技术。逆向工程与一般的设计制造过程相反,是先有实物后有模型。仿形加工就是一种典型的逆向工程应用。
3、你好,安卓逆向一般指的是做安卓逆向开发,职位也类似于正向开发的JAVA程序员;但是需要具备很多的知识储备,JAVA正向开发,底层的C,汇编语言,了解各种协议算法加解密,会脱壳加固,比较多哈。但是这类资深大牛的工资都是年薪计算的;正向开发的人员相对饱和,逆向工程师的需求也很大。
怎样在labview中显示程序运行的时间,就是将整个程序运行的时间显示在前...
用顺序结构。在第一层中放上一个时钟作为开始时间。中间层放你的程序。第三层放一个时钟记下时间。
LabVIEW的exe是会自动运行的。其实你的程序并不是没有执行,而是只执行了一次就结束了。所以你在后面板上需要将整个程序放到一个while循环框里,这样就会循环执行了。如图,while循环中还要加上定时循环的时间,至少是1ms,否则CPU占用率会非常高。或者可以直接使用“定时循环”结构框。
在目标电脑上安装LabVIEW以及相关驱动和工具包,然后将vi或者整个项目拷贝到目标电脑上。然而安装LabVIEW和各种工具包会比较耗费时间,且vi可以被任意修改,容易引起误操作,如果只是运行程序,则不推荐这种方法。
当然你也可以在你的调用程序中点击相应的子VI右键,然后在里面高等设置子VI节点,也可以设置是否需要显示调用时子VI的面板。 弹出子VI的面板,就是显示与否。与主程序如何做没有多大关系。如果设置了要显示,只要子程序运行了(调用)或加载(加载显示),都会显示子VI前面板。